- Mehmet UzDec 09, 2024 · 8 months agoIn a monopolistic competition, the price of cryptocurrencies is influenced by factors such as market liquidity, trading volume, and market manipulation. Market liquidity refers to the ease with which a cryptocurrency can be bought or sold without causing significant price changes. Higher liquidity generally leads to more stable prices. Trading volume, on the other hand, reflects the level of activity in the market and can impact price volatility. Market manipulation, including practices such as pump and dump schemes, can artificially inflate or deflate cryptocurrency prices.
